Understanding Your Space: How to Assess Your Living Room Space

Before shopping for furniture, take a good look at your living room. Take measurements of the dimensions and note any architectural features like doors, or fireplaces. This will assist in deciding what pieces will fit comfortably without cramping the space.

  • Plan your layout: Use online tools or a simple sketch to play around with different furniture arrangements.
  • Consider traffic flow: Make sure there’s enough space for people to move freely.
  • Focus on functionality: Think about how you use the room. Do you need more seating, storage, or surface space?

Choosing Furniture Styles to Your Home Aesthetic

Your living room furniture should match your home’s overall style. Whether you love modern minimalism, cozy farmhouse vibes, or eclectic designs, there’s furniture to suit every taste.

  • Modern: Look for sleek designs, neutral colors, and minimalist aesthetics.
  • Traditional: Opt for classic shapes, rich woods, and ornate details.
  • Eclectic: Mix and match textures for a unique look.

Choosing Comfort and Durability

Living room furniture is an investment, so choose pieces that are both comfortable and durable. Here’s what to keep in mind:

  • Material: Choose fabrics that are easy to clean—especially if you have kids or pets.
  • Construction: Strong frames and high-density foam cushions ensure durability.
  • Comfort: Test furniture in-store when possible, or read reviews to gauge comfort levels.

Budget-Friendly Furniture Options

Furnishing your living room doesn’t have to be expensive. With a little planning, you can find functional and affordable options:

  • Shop sales: Watch for seasonal discounts and promotions.
  • Buy secondhand: Check thrift stores or online marketplaces for gently used furniture.
  • Prioritize: Invest in key pieces like a sofa, and save on accent furniture or decor.
